Date | 12th March 1938 | |
To Rm.{William Robotham - Chief Engineer} from Ev.{Ivan Evernden - coachwork} c. to Rm{William Robotham - Chief Engineer}/RC.{R. Childs} 6153. Da{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}/Ev.{Ivan Evernden - coachwork}11/N.12.3.38. ------------------- Re: 1.B.50 - Radio. ------------------- Will you please order a Philco radio for fitting into the back of the division on/1.B.50 to replace the Motorola which we have already asked you to obtain. All previous remarks concerning the Motorola used in this position apply to the Philco i.e. the way the controls come out of the set, and whether it is possible to turn the set on its side. This car has running boards, and therefore can have a running board aerial. Da{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}/Ev.{Ivan Evernden - coachwork} | ||
